
In 2019, Ubisoft revealed a brand new esports title known as Roller Champions at E3. Since then they have already built a passionate community around the game after having alpha and beta tests over the last few years. Originally we expected Roller Champions to release sometime in 2020 and then that turned into Q4 2021.
Recently, the development team on Roller Champs announced that they have to delay the game until late Spring 2022 as they look to polish everything up. This was revealed in the official discord server for the game as you can see the statement below:
